Safe towing starts with ensuring the tow automobile appropriates to tow the trailer. You can select the ideal trailer or caravan to match your tow car or buy a tow lorry to match your trailer type and pulling needs. While modern automobiles are lighter and provide much better solution for regular car, some do not have the required features for towing.

You might tow just 1 trailer (campers, box or boat) at once. Individuals must not ride in trailers/caravans. A removable tow combining can be removed when not in usage. This will stay clear of obstructing the number plate and minimise the danger to people strolling behind the lorry. When pulling a trailer (including campers), bear in mind to: enable the extra size and size of the trailer when getting in trafficallow for its tendency to 'reduce in' on corners and curvesaccelerate, brake and guide smoothly and delicately to avoid swayingallow for the results of cross-winds, passing traffic and irregular road surfacesleave a much longer stopping distance in between you and the automobile ahead; increase the void for longer, heavier trailers and permit much more range in poor driving conditionsuse a reduced gear in both hand-operated and automatic vehicles when taking a trip downhill to make your cars and truck much easier to control and minimize the strain on your brakesallow more time and range to surpass and prevent 'cutting off' the lorry you are overtaking when going back to the left lanefit a reversing camera or obtain a person to view the back of the trailer when you reversereversing is challenging and takes practicenot stand up trafficpull off the roadway where it is safe to do so, and where it won't create a build-up of website traffic unable to overtakebe conscious that your vehicle and trailer will tend to guide when a hefty car surpasses you.

A trailer with one axle team near the middle of the lots. Component of the tons hinges on the tow hitch of the lugging vehicle. A trailer with 2 axle teams. The front axle team is steered by link to the tow lorry (Towing Near Me). A lot of the load hinges on the trailer.
The tow hitch is in front of the back axle of the tow vehicle. It's essential to pick the appropriate trailer kind and configuration for simpler lots circulation and restraint. Your vehicle requires to be equipped suitably for the trailer's kind and dimension, consisting of: tow bars and combinings of a suitable kind and capacityelectrical sockets for lightingsuitable brake links if requiredextra mirrors for towing large trailers if requiredoptional rear-view camerathese help to see traffic behind you however do not change the demand for mirrors.

Guarantee the lots is properly protected to the trailer. Maintain all your towing equipment on a regular basis, including car and trailer, to guarantee safe towing. Ask your trailer or car dealership, RACQ or other proficient service representative to examine that the: lugging automobile and trailer are in a roadworthy and risk-free conditiontrailer's wheel bearings, suspension and brakes are in great functioning condition.
